As an independent author, you have many options for publishing your book. One option is to use a service like Ingram Spark Publishing. In this article, we will discuss the pros and cons of using Ingram Spark so that you can decide if it is the right choice for you.

The Pros:

1. Ingram Spark offers print on demand (POD) printing, which means that your book will be printed only when someone orders it. This can save you money on printing costs since you will not have to order many books upfront.

2. Your book will be available for sale on IngramSpark.com and through their distribution network, including major online retailers such as Amazon, Barnes & Noble, and Chapters/Indigo.

3. You will retain all rights to your book and will receive a higher royalty rate than you would from most traditional publishers.

4. Ingram Spark has no upfront costs and offers a variety of marketing and promotional tools to help you market your book effectively.

The Cons:

1. While Ingram Spark does offer worldwide distribution, they are primarily focused on the U.S. market. This may limit your book’s exposure in other countries.

2. Some authors have had problems with customer service and have found it difficult to get their questions answered promptly.
